V God’s Warning: Ethereum Needs "Garbage Collection" as Protocol Complexity Threatens Its Long-Term Vitality

Vitalik Buterin recently published a profound reflection: no matter how powerful a blockchain is, if it is built upon hundreds of thousands of lines of code and complex cryptography into a “massive chaotic body,” it will ultimately fail all three key tests of trustlessness, decentralization, and self-sovereignty. This is not a technical detail issue but a strategic choice that affects Ethereum’s century-long vitality.

The Triple Dangers of Protocol Complexity

V神 points out that even if a protocol has hundreds of thousands of nodes, possesses 49% Byzantine fault tolerance, and is fully verified through quantum-resistant cryptography, it still faces fatal flaws if the protocol itself is overly complex:

Danger Dimension Specific Manifestation Long-term Consequence
Loss of Trustlessness Users must trust a few senior developers to understand protocol properties Protocol discourse power is monopolized by a few
Failure to Pass Departure Tests When existing client teams leave, new teams struggle to match quality Ecosystem development is locked, innovation hindered
Loss of Self-Sovereignty Even the most technically capable cannot fully understand the protocol Users lose true control over their assets

This means every part of the protocol could become a source of systemic risk, especially when these parts interact in complex ways.

Why Protocols Unavoidably Become Bloated

The core contradiction lies in the dilemma of backward compatibility. V神 admits that during Ethereum development, changes are often “additive” rather than “subtractive.” With each upgrade, for the sake of maintaining compatibility, new features are added while old features are rarely removed. As a result, the protocol inevitably becomes bloated over time.

This is precisely why, over the past decade, Ethereum has unconsciously sacrificed decentralization and privacy in pursuit of mainstream adoption and scalability. Running nodes becomes more difficult, data leaks become more severe, and block construction becomes more centralized—all side effects of accumulating protocol complexity.

The Solution: Clear “Garbage Collection” Mechanisms

V神 proposes that Ethereum development needs a clear “simplification” or “garbage collection” function, with three standards:

Three Core Standards

  • Minimize code lines: Reduce overall protocol complexity
  • Avoid unnecessary technical dependencies: Do not introduce fundamentally complex new components as key dependencies
  • Increase invariants: Make core properties that the protocol relies on clearer. For example, EIP-6780 (removing selfdestruct) adds the property that “each block can only change N storage slots,” greatly simplifying client development

Two Types of Garbage Collection

Incremental Approach: Gradually simplify existing features to make them more streamlined and reasonable

Large-scale Garbage Collection: Completely replace outdated technologies, such as replacing PoW with PoS

Innovative Solution: Rosetta-style Backward Compatibility

V神 proposes a clever compromise—rather than completely removing complex features, downgrade them into smart contract code instead of making them mandatory parts of the protocol. This way, new client developers do not need to handle them.

Specific examples include:

  • After upgrading to fully native account abstraction, all old transaction types can be phased out
  • Replace existing precompiles with EVM or RISC-V code
  • Ultimately change the virtual machine from EVM to RISC-V

This approach preserves backward compatibility while avoiding protocol bloat.

This is the “2026 Repair Plan” Core Content

Interestingly, this perspective on protocol simplification aligns with V神’s recent series of statements emphasizing that Ethereum needs to return to decentralization, privacy, and self-sovereignty. V神 explicitly states that 2026 will be a critical year for Ethereum to “regain lost ground,” no longer compromising core values for mainstream adoption.

Protocol simplification is the infrastructural foundation of this repair plan. Only when the protocol is sufficiently simple and easy to understand can Ethereum truly restore its original intent of trustlessness, decentralization, and self-sovereignty.

Summary

V神’s discourse touches on a long-ignored issue: protocol simplicity is a prerequisite for trustlessness, decentralization, and self-sovereignty. Pursuing short-term feature gains by continuously piling on complexity appears to meet various needs but, in reality, erodes Ethereum’s most core values.

This is not a quick fix, but it reflects a profound strategic shift Ethereum is undertaking—from “pursuing scale and adoption” back to “pursuing sovereignty and decentralization.” The process will be long, but it is necessary to build a “century-long decentralized superstructure that transcends empire and ideological rise and fall.”
